    Here is video of Donnie Thompson, shw, breaking the historic total barrier of 2,900 pounds with his 2,905 pound total at the IPA Senior Nationals yesterday in York, Pennsylvania. Thompson squatted 1,235, benched 910, and deadlifted 760 pounds.
